Sedona is a city that straddles the county line between Coconino and Yavapai counties in the northern Verde Valley region of the U.S. state of Arizona. As of the 2010 census, its population was 10,031. It is within the Coconino National Forest.

Sedona's main attraction is its array of red sandstone formations. The formations appear to glow in brilliant orange and red when illuminated by the rising or setting sun. The red rocks form a popular backdrop for many activities, ranging from spiritual pursuits to the hundreds of hiking and mountain biking trails. Sedona is also the home to the nationally recognized McDonald's with turquoise arches, instead of the traditional Golden Arches.

Sedona is a city in Arizona state in USA with a population of 10341 residents.. The poverty rate of Sedona is 10.9%, which is 22% lower than national average. The typical household in Sedona earns $57434 a year, compared to the national median of $67,500. Nearly 41.1% of households earn less than $50,000 a year compared to 39% national rate. The unemployment rate of Sedona remained 5.7%, which is 21% higher than national rate. Nearly 1 times comparable to 4.7% national rate, according to the Census.

Cost of living in Sedona is 135, which is 35% higher than national average. In Sedona, only 50% of adults have a bachelor's degree and 25% have some college but no degree. Median home value in Sedona is $510800 , which is 122% higher than national average. While median income in Sedona remained $57434, which is 15% lower than national average.
